Biography

Laurie Riemer has dedicated herself full time to providing dispute resolution services since 1990. She has extensive experience in mediating and arbitrating thousands of diverse cases, including complex, multiparty tort and commercial litigation disputes. She was appointed by the Chief Justice of the Supreme Court of Florida to serve on the Supreme Court Committee on Mediation and Arbitration Training (1993-2001). Laurie was also appointed in 1999-2001 as Chair-person of the Mediation Committee of the Dade County Bar Association.

She has had advanced ADR training from the Harvard Law School Negotiation Project (1995), the Collins Center for Public Policy and the United States Postal Service.

Laurie's mediation strategies are cost effective, efficient, and result in early resolutions which avoid expensive litigation costs and the stress of trials. She has been recognized by her peers as a preeminent mediator with her AV rating in Martindale-Hubbell and her selection as a Top Mediator in Florida Trends Florida Legal Elite, and as a Top Rated Lawyer in The Miami Herald, and the Daily Business Review, and as on of the Top 25 Alternative Dispute Resolution Firms by the South Florida Business Journal

Laurie Riemer was appointed as a Special Master in Shareholders derivative suit and has served as an umpire in insurance coverage disputes and also in several blasting/mining  and mold cases. She served as an arbitrator in a class action suit involving 2000 plaintiffs and also in employment, real estate and condominium disputes. She serves as a U.S. District Court Class Action Neutral for The Collins Center for Public Policy. She was selected by the CPR Institute for Dispute Resolution to serve on their Panel of Distinguished Neutrals and also by the United States Postal Services as a mediator in their REDRESS program. She served as a moderator for a Women's Forum of The Young Presidents' Organization.

From 1982 through 1990, she was a civil trial and transactional lawyer representing both plaintiffs and defendants in state, federal and appellate courts. In 1981and 82, Laurie was a law intern for the Honorable Judge William M. Hoeveler, who was the number one rated United States District Court Judge for the Southern District of Florida.
